DENVER, CO 6/6/2025. On June 6, 2025, at 5:53 PM MT, a traffic incident involving a cyclist and a passenger vehicle was reported near the intersection of 16th Street and Blake Street in Denver’s Union Station neighborhood. The incident occurred approximately 0.1 miles southeast of the cross streets Blake St/16th St. Despite the dark-lighted conditions of the roadway, initial reports indicate no serious injuries or fatalities. The cyclist reportedly failed to obey traffic signs or signals, leading to a collision with a passenger car that was traveling south. This marks the 293rd traffic incident in the Union Station area since June 6, 2024.
